Purpose This study investigates the role of AI awareness, academic level, information sources, and educational support in shaping accounting students’ Attitudes toward AI in Auditing. The research aims to provide actionable insights for integrating AI into accounting education and equipping students with the necessary skills to adapt to a rapidly evolving auditing profession. Design/methodology/approach The study adopts a quantitative research design using an online survey distributed to 369 accounting students from Jordanian universities. The survey instrument comprised 20 items across five constructs. Data analysis was conducted using PLS-SEM via ADANCO software to examine both direct and indirect relationships among the constructs. Findings The results reveal that AI awareness is a critical mediator, significantly enhancing students’ Attitudes toward AI in Auditing in auditing. Academic level, credible information sources, and strong educational support were identified as key factors influencing AI awareness. The findings highlight the importance of experiential learning, access to reliable educational resources, and institutional support in fostering positive attitudes toward AI adoption in auditing contexts. The study empirically supports the Constructivism and Diffusion of Innovation theories, demonstrating the relevance of interactive learning environments and perceived practical benefits in shaping students’ readiness to adopt new technologies. Originality/value This study makes a unique contribution by integrating Constructivism and Diffusion of Innovation frameworks to explain the adoption of AI in auditing education. It offers practical strategies for educators and policymakers, including the integration of AI-focused modules, hands-on training, and enhanced support systems, to prepare students for the demands of AI-driven auditing practices. The research provides a foundation for future studies exploring AI adoption in accounting and auditing education across diverse contexts.
